How to Choose 3d Led Display Screen

  • Determining The Purpose And Use

    The first thing to do when choosing a 3D LED display is determining its usage precisely. A business should determine why it is purchasing the screen and where it will use it. Is it going to be used for outdoor advertisement, event display, or enhancement of the interior environment? Clarity of purpose will guide the choice of many aspects, such as resolution, size, and brightness.

  • Opting For The Right Size And Resolution

    After determining the purpose, the next decision element is the height and resolution of the 3D LED screen. Larger spaces or those viewed from a distance would need a bigger screen with a low pixel density (PPM). On the contrary, in smaller areas, or where the viewer may be close to the display, finer pixel density will be required for sharper display resolution and quality. A perfect size and resolution combination ensures optimal performance and a pleasing visual experience.

  • Performance And Brightness Level

    One more very important aspect concerning the display is its brightness level, especially depending on where it will be used: indoor or outdoor. Outside LED displays are required to be brighter since they should be able to overcome the sunlight, while those used indoors will not have to be as bright but should not be dim either. In this case, the performance of the screen will vary depending on the light condition of the environment in which the screen will be used. Performing various tests on the screen will give a clearer picture of performance and brightness.

  • Technology Of 3D Display

    Various technologies are available for forming 3D LED displays, including lenticular, holographic, and autostereoscopic. Each technology has its strength and limitation, so it is important to choose one that will give the desired effect. For instance, lenticular is currently the most common because of its simple operation, while holographic is catching up but is still expensive.

Maintenance and Repair of 3d Led Display Screen

  • Regular Cleaning

    Dust, smog, and stains left on 3D LED displays will reduce their brightness and resolution, and graphic quality, among other things. Basic cleaning should be done regularly with a soft, non-abrasive cloth and non-corrosive substances. For outdoor applications that are constantly exposed to environmental elements, cleaning might need to be more frequent.

  • Software Updates And Management

    Routine software on management and updates must be performed to ensure that the 3D LED display works very well. Content display, resolution, and level of interactivity will depend on the software used in the display. Installing patches and updates once in a while as advised by the manufacturer is crucial in preventing possible breaches and improving functionality to enhance performance further.

  • Temperature Maintenance

    A few of the 3D LED displays are very likely to develop problems, especially when they operate at elevated temperatures. To avoid this, it is important to ensure that there is adequate ventilation around these displays, especially positioned in the shade or an area with poor air circulation, to prevent overheating. Overheating can be catastrophic and possibly damage the display. Fans and heat sinks are used to cool it down, as suggested by the manufacturer.

  • Monitoring For Physical Damage

    Physical damage to 3D LED displays also degrades their performance. Cracks, dead pixels, or faulty light emission should be immediately attended to. Users should always undertake regular inspections so that any signs of wear and tear are addressed to give optimal use from the display screen.

  • Calibration And Color Accuracy

    A 3D LED display will require constant calibration to ensure it is bright, vibrant, and accurate. This may be done by adjusting the brightness, contrast, and color to suit the environment's lighting conditions or the advertisement's content. Calibration tools and techniques are often provided by manufacturers of 3D LED displays, and regular use will ensure the screen remains in optimum professional condition.

    Q1. What is a 3D LED display screen?

    A1. This is a screen or display device that uses light-emitting diodes to project three-dimensional images or videos. It can be used for varied applications, such as advertising, entertainment, education, and even scientific visualizations. Its main strength is its ability to provide a realistic and innovative viewing experience, which cannot be matched by conventional display technologies.

    Q2. How does a 3D LED display work?

    A2. 3D LED displays give the viewer an impression of depth by using various techniques, like lenticular lenses or autostereoscopy. These techniques ensure that different pictures are given to different angles of the viewer's eyes to create various depth perception illusions. This makes the display appear three-dimensional rather than just flat.
